What Is IPv4 Leasing?
IPv4 leasing is an arrangement in which the owner of an IPv4 address block allows another organization to use that address space for a specific period.
The important distinction is between ownership and usage. In a typical lease, the original holder retains ownership of the IPv4 block while the customer receives permission to use the addresses according to the terms of the agreement.
The leased addresses may be used for different legitimate purposes, including servers, hosting infrastructure, cloud services, network expansion, applications, VPN infrastructure, and other internet-facing systems.
The exact terms depend on the provider and agreement. These terms can include the number of addresses, lease duration, monthly or annual price, acceptable-use requirements, technical responsibilities, renewal conditions, and procedures for ending the lease.

4. Review the Address Reputation
Not all IPv4 addresses have the same history.
An address may have previously been associated with websites, email systems, hosting services, or other online infrastructure. If an address has a poor reputation or appears on relevant blocklists, it could create operational problems.
Before accepting a block, businesses should consider checking:
- IP blacklist status
- Abuse history
- Reputation signals
- Routing information
- Registry records
- Reverse DNS requirements
- RPKI and routing authorization where applicable
A reputable provider should be willing to explain the condition and history of the address space.

6. Complete Technical Authorization
An IPv4 lease does not automatically mean that the customer can announce the addresses from its network.
The necessary routing and authorization information must be correctly configured. Depending on the arrangement, this can involve Letter of Authorization documentation, Internet Routing Registry information, RPKI/ROA configuration, and coordination with the customer’s upstream provider.
The exact requirements vary according to the network setup, registry environment, and provider.
7. Configure BGP Routing
For organizations that need to announce leased IPv4 space, Border Gateway Protocol (BGP) is an important part of the process.
BGP allows networks to advertise routes to other networks across the internet. The customer may need to announce the leased prefix from its own Autonomous System Number (ASN), depending on the arrangement.
The upstream provider may also require documentation confirming that the customer is authorized to use the address space.
Incorrect routing information can prevent the addresses from being reachable, so technical configuration should be completed carefully.

What Is the Difference Between Leasing and Buying IPv4?
The main difference is ownership.
When a company buys an IPv4 block through a valid transfer process, ownership of the address resources may be transferred according to the applicable registry policies and transaction requirements.
With leasing, the original holder generally retains ownership while another organization receives permission to use the addresses for a defined period.
Leasing therefore tends to be more suitable when flexibility and lower initial costs are important. Purchasing can make more sense for organizations that expect to require the address space for a long time and want permanent control.
Neither option is automatically better. The right choice depends on the organization’s budget, technical requirements, expected usage period, and long-term network strategy.
What Should You Check Before Leasing IPv4?
Choosing an IPv4 provider requires more than comparing monthly prices.
First, confirm that the provider can demonstrate legitimate control over the address space. You should also understand how routing authorization and registry-related documentation will be handled.
Next, investigate the reputation of the addresses. A low-cost block may become expensive if it causes connectivity, email delivery, or reputation problems.
It is also important to understand the provider’s support process. Ask what happens if an address becomes unusable, receives abuse complaints, or experiences routing problems.
Finally, read the agreement carefully. Make sure the lease duration, renewal process, payment terms, acceptable-use requirements, and termination conditions are clearly documented.
